How they compare

Croatia currently reports 1.48 against 1.43 in Bosnia and Herzegovina, a difference of 0.05.

The two have swapped places 44 times across 87 shared years of data; in 1940 it was Croatia ahead.

Bosnia and Herzegovina ranks 39th and Croatia ranks 37th of 193 countries.

Across the 9 decades both report, Bosnia and Herzegovina averaged higher in 4 and Croatia in 5.

Head to head by decade

Decade Bosnia and Herzegovina Croatia Difference Ahead
1940s -2.79 -2.28 0.5083 Croatia
1950s -1.93 -1.79 0.1325 Croatia
1960s -1.79 -1.47 0.3106 Croatia
1970s -0.6738 -0.6519 0.0218 Croatia
1980s -1.11 -1.21 0.1029 Bosnia and Herzegovina
1990s -0.6262 -0.3065 0.3197 Croatia
2000s 0.1177 -0.0107 0.1284 Bosnia and Herzegovina
2010s 0.6729 0.4817 0.1912 Bosnia and Herzegovina
2020s 1.25 1.04 0.2063 Bosnia and Herzegovina

Averages of every year both report within each decade.
